Job Description:

Our client's financial reporting advisory team is seeking a manager to work on technical reviews of a portfolio of annual reports of publicly traded and other higher risk companies, working with the audit team to confirm compliance with financial reporting standards, company legislation, and regulatory requirements.

Responsibilities

  • Work with Managers, Directors, and Partners within both the technical practice, the audit stream, and across the wider firm.
  • Maintain and encourage an open and constructive environment for technical support and advice.
  • Bring pre-existing technical knowledge and experience to the FRA team and contribute to all output areas.
  • Provide support and supervision to junior team members.

The individual will support the FRA Directors and Senior Managers, ultimately reporting to the firm's technical partner, and will be responsible for:

  • Providing clear and practical solutions to technical financial reporting queries in collaboration with Directors and Senior Managers.
  • Assisting in the preparation and presentation of internal financial reporting training, updates, and seminars.
  • Writing articles and materials on financial reporting for internal communications.
  • Monitoring external developments in financial reporting areas and developing action plans accordingly.

Requirements

This role is suited for individuals with experience in a technical department of a major accounting firm or auditors with strong technical aptitude seeking a technical role.

You will:

  • Be ACA/ICAS qualified or hold an overseas equivalent qualification.
  • Have experience as a Manager or Assistant Manager in a technical team or relevant experience in financial reporting, including audit.
  • Preferably have insurance or asset management experience.
  • Have practical experience reviewing annual reports, especially for listed companies.
  • Possess knowledge of IFRSs, UK GAAP, and the Companies Act, and an understanding of the wider financial reporting environment.
  • Be capable of applying technical knowledge to complex issues.
  • Have strong communication skills and the ability to build relationships.
  • Be a team player and self-motivated.
  • Be proactive and motivated to develop their financial reporting skills.
